Re: Vintage LP pickups

Post by Danger Mouse »

The supposed history of the Wilkinson pickups in the Vintage LPs are that they are closely based on the original PAF humbuckers, as Trevor Wilkinson and Seth Lover were mates and Seth gave Trevor the specs from the originals. Regardless, they are very good for what they are.
